ADCCAC – the Arbitral Panel
Overview
Arbitration under the ADCCAC 2013 Procedural Regulations of Arbitration (the 2013 Regulations) are conducted by a panel of arbitrations (the Panel), which can be formed of one or more arbitrators, provided it is an odd number (article 8).
If the parties do not agree on the number of arbitrators, a sole arbitrator shall be appointed unless it appears to the ADCCAC Centre (the Centre) due to the amount, nature or circumstances of the dispute that more than one arbitrator should be appointed.
Definitions
ADCCAC: The Abu Dhabi Commercial Conciliation & Arbitration Centre
The Centre: This term is used interchangeably with the ADCCAC. Notifications are sent to the Centre marked for the attention of the Director (article 4)
The Director : The director of the Centre
The Panel: A sole arbitrator or odd number of arbitrators in charge of adjudicating a dispute referred to arbitration
The Committee: This is the body at the Centre which is in charge of administering commercial arbitration cases
The 2013 Regulations: ADACCAC Procedural Regulations of Arbitration 2013
